Why noble prize is not for mathematicians

Answer»

The apocryphal ANSWER is that the Swedish mathematician Gosta Magnus Mittag-Leffler had an AFFAIR with ALFRED Nobel's love interest. INFURIATED by that, he decided to exclude MATHEMATICS as an awards category. ... Alfred Nobel wanted to award people for "practical" inventions. He thought mathematics was too theoretical.
